About the role

The Method Validation Scientist is responsible for the design, execution, and documentation of analytical method validations in accordance with regulatory guidelines and internal quality systems. This role ensures that all laboratory methods used for testing and analysis are scientifically sound, robust, and compliant with relevant regulatory requirements:

  • Develop, plan, and execute method validation protocols for new and existing analytical methods
  • Perform method transfer, verification, and qualification activities across laboratories and/or manufacturing sites
  • Prepare and review validation protocols, summary reports, SOPs, and technical documentation
  • Perform troubleshooting and optimisation of analytical methods where required
  • Participate in audits and provide support during regulatory inspections
  • Maintain accurate records, data integrity, and compliance with laboratory standards
  • Provide technical support and training to junior analysts where appropriate
